Amy Webb is a quantitative futurist, best-selling author, and founder of one of the world’s most influential strategic foresight consulting firms. She is CEO of the Future Today Institute (FTI), where she pioneered a data-driven, technology-led foresight methodology that reveals the future though trends and scenarios. Together with her colleagues, she identifies white spaces, opportunities and threats early enough for action. FTI advises executive leadership of large corporations and investment banks, as well three-star admirals and generals and senior government leaders. FTI’s annual Tech Trends report is downloaded more than 1 million times a year. Regarded as one of the most important voices on the futures of technology (with specializations in both AI and synthetic biology), Amy is the author of four books, including the international bestseller The Big Nine and her most recent, The Genesis Machine, which was listed as one of the best nonfiction books of 2022 by The New Yorker. Amy also regularly collaborates with writers, directors and showrunners on films and shows set in the future or where science and technology play a central role. Recent projects include The First (on Hulu) and Black Panther. She is a member of the Academy of Television Arts & Sciences. She is ranked on the Thinkers50 list of the 50 most influential management thinkers globally and was ranked by Poets & Quants as one of the most impactful business school professors in the world.
